  • Patent number: 5446897
    Abstract: A method and apparatus for automatically associating physical network addresses with logical identifiers in local area networks. The physical network address is transmitted to a central administrator of the local area network, where the association between such address and a logical identifier is made. In the case where a new device is being installed on the network, the logical identifier may be an arbitrary word, number, or combination thereof which is supplied by the operator at the central administrator. In the situation where a device is being replaced, the logical identifier is the same as the identifier of the replaced device, while the physical network address of the replacement device is substituted in the association for the address of the replaced device. A compilation of the associations is maintained at the central administrator, and the associations are transmitted back to the devices being installed or replaced, as well as other devices on the network.
